The purpose of this project is to explore the P5.js library in terms of a potential tool for generative art.

Examples will show various ways to refactor similar code.

Notes and programming principles

Randomness

Core technique in generative art. Used to effect the curveVertex function of p5js

Repetition & Structure

The Triangles are based on a repeating grid of alternating rectangles. When randomness is introduced, the points on the grid can be moved around to produce the interlocking effect.

Recursion

The Hypnotic Squares effect uses recursion within the drawrect function. This function calls itself repeatedly with a reducing sized square until the steps are reduced to zero
